    When in Italy, you have to try this place! This place originated in Florence. They have expanded to other parts of Italy and even to Los Angeles and New York. We went when we visited Rome in the summer and we lined up before the shop opened. And we weren't the only ones that had the idea of getting sandwiches in the morning. Even though it was a long line, it moved quickly and there were 2 lines because there were 2 storefronts, one at each corner. We waited probably for about 20-30 minutes. The menu is behind the counter and if you know your food names in Italian, you should be able to know what to order. You can also go on their website and they have the menu in English. We tried Beatrice, Tartufo, and the one with the suckling pig. One sandwich was too much for me! You can ask them to split it in half for you, which in retrospect, we could have shared the sandwiches. But we wanted to try as many items as possible! To call this a sandwich is almost inadequate. This creation is made with fresh focaccia. It has the delicious smell of olive oil and the perfect chew. It's a good vehicle for all the delicious meats and vegetables in the sandwich. My favorite sandwiches were the Beatrice and the one with the suckling pig. This is considered a street food, but it can get messy when you start eating. There was no outside or inside seating. We had to eat right outside the shop. We couldn't even wait to take a bite as soon as we got the sandwiches. This place is well worth the wait!     I was walking by when I saw almost no line at All'Antico Vinaio - Roma! You can't pass a gift when it's presented to you, right? I took a look at the menu board, then all of a sudden there were 8 people in line! Humph...okay I had to join the queue. When my turn came, I ordered the Tartufo1 panino. This is foccacia bread sliced in half to make it very thin, stracchino (like fluffy cream cheese), cream of truffle spread, mortadella with truffle bits and arugula. The cheese makes the truffle sauce less salty. Mortadella is perfect for this combination sandwich since it's light. The arugula adds some bite. The best combination! Ordering was easy. The cashier & sandwich maker were both nice. Some people immediately start eating their panino. I got mine and enjoyed it in the comfort of a hotel room. Note: Take out only. During their busy time, they have an adjoining shop open too.
